A Record-Setting Performance For The Women's Golf Team

September 21, 2015 | Women's Golf

MADISON – Sunday was a top ten weather day in Madison as far as golfers are concerned— sunny skies, temperatures hovering in the upper 60s and only a slight 5 mph wind. The University of Colorado women's golf team took full advantage of the perfect conditions, winning the stroke play portion of the East & West Match Play Challenge, while Esther Lee earned medalist honors, firing a school record 8-under par 64 in the second round,

Lee shot 7-under par, 137 over the two rounds, breaking the previous CU 36-hole record of 138 set more than seven years ago by Emily Childs. Her 64 in the second round is now the lowest 18 hole score ever recorded in school history, besting the previous record, 66, set in 2011. Another record Lee set in her second round, the eight birdies she drained is now the most ever recorded in a single-round. Her 31 on the back side tied a program record. In comparison to both the men and women's CU golfers, past and present, her 64 ranks among one of the lowest scores all-time. She also set a University Ridge Course women's collegiate 18-hole scoring record, replacing the previous 65 course record held by four players.

As a whole, Colorado was the only squad to post a sub-par team score, shooting 11-under, 292-277—569, which ranks as the third lowest team score in the CU record book and their 277 in the second round matched the lowest all-time 18 hole mark and tied the University Ridge Golf Course's lowest 18-hole score ever recorded in a women's collegiate meet.

Senior Alexis Keating also turned in a stellar performance, shooting 71-69—140 or 4-under par and finished stroke play in third place. She combined to drain nine birdies over the 36 holes and it was the first time in program history that two players finished in the top three of an event.

The Buffaloes will face No. 4 seed Indiana on Monday in the first of two match play rounds.
